颠倒给定的 32 位无符号整数的二进制位。 示例: 输入: 43261596 输出: 964176192 解释: 43261596 的二进制表示形式为 00000010100101000001111010011100 , 返回 964176192,其二进制表示形式 ...
Reverse bits of a given bits unsigned integer. Example : Example : Note: Note that in some languages such as Java, there is no unsigned integer type. In this case, both input and output will be given ...
2015-03-08 10:15 5 16324 推荐指数:
颠倒给定的 32 位无符号整数的二进制位。 示例: 输入: 43261596 输出: 964176192 解释: 43261596 的二进制表示形式为 00000010100101000001111010011100 , 返回 964176192,其二进制表示形式 ...
Reverse bits of a given 32 bits unsigned integer. For example, given input 43261596 (represented in binary as 00000010100101000001111010011100 ...
解题思路: 1.循环交换位,交换16次即可。第i位与第33-i位交换。 代码如下: 2.将该数所有的位顺序颠倒即可(移位方向相反),即将原来的100变为001. ...
Given a positive integer, check whether it has alternating bits: namely, if two adjacent bits will always have different values. Example ...
& 与 按位与,如果对应的二进制位同时为 1,那么计算结果才为 ...
转自:https://blog.csdn.net/YPJMFC/article/details/78246971 我们知道,计算机最基本的操作单元是字节(byte),一个字节由8个位(bit)组成,一个位只能存储一个0或1,其实也就是高低电平。无论多么复杂的逻辑、庞大的数据、酷炫的界面 ...
Given two integers L and R, find the count of numbers in the range [L, R] (inclusive) having a prime number of set bits in their binary ...
leetcode -- 二进制 在学习编程语言的运算符时,大部分语言都会有与,或等二进制运算符,我在初期学习这些运算符的时候,并没有重点留意这些运算符,并且在后续的业务代码中也没有频繁的使用过,直到后来的一些算法题目和源码中经常遇到它们的身影,这些二进制运算符相比普通的运算符具有更快的效率 ...